What Is Solensia and How Does It Work for Cats with Arthritis?

Solensia is a monoclonal antibody treatment specifically designed for cats suffering from arthritis. It targets nerve growth factor (NGF), which plays a key role in pain signaling. By inhibiting NGF, Solensia reduces pain and inflammation, leading to improved mobility and quality of life for affected cats.

According to the American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A), Solensia represents a breakthrough in veterinary medicine, offering a targeted approach to pain management for cats with osteoarthritis.

Solensia is administered as an injection and typically provides pain relief for up to a month. This treatment is part of a broader management plan that may also include weight management, dietary changes, and physical therapy. Understanding the unique biology of cats helps veterinarians tailor treatment to individual needs.

The Cornell University College of Veterinary Medicine describes Solensia as a significant advancement in the treatment of chronic pain in cats, highlighting its unique mechanism of action.

Arthritis in cats can result from various factors, including age, obesity, genetic predispositions, and previous joint injuries. These factors contribute to the degradation of joint cartilage, leading to pain and diminished mobility.

The American Animal Hospital Association estimates that about 60% of cats over 6 years old show signs of arthritis, indicating a large segment of the feline population may benefit from treatments like Solensia.

What Are the Key Uses of Solensia in the Treatment of Feline Arthritis?

The key uses of Solensia in the treatment of feline arthritis include pain management, improved mobility, and long-term joint health.

  1. Pain management
  2. Improved mobility
  3. Long-term joint health
  4. Minimal side effects
  5. Ease of administration
  6. Support for overall well-being

These points highlight the diverse benefits of Solensia in addressing feline arthritis while considering different perspectives on treatment options.

  1. Pain Management:
    Pain management with Solensia occurs through its active ingredient, frunevetmab, which targets pain pathways specifically in cats. Studies show that frunevetmab works by inhibiting nerve growth factor (NGF), a key player in pain signaling. In a clinical trial by Pande et al. (2020), cats treated with Solensia demonstrated a significant reduction in pain scores within the first week of treatment. This improvement allows cats to experience a better quality of life, engaging more with their surroundings and owners.

  2. Improved Mobility:
    Improved mobility is achieved by reducing arthritis-related discomfort. Solensia allows cats to move more freely and perform daily activities, such as jumping or playing. The Journal of Feline Medicine and Surgery published a study showcasing that 75% of treated cats showed enhanced physical mobility. This increase in activity can prevent further joint deterioration and promote muscle strengthening, which is critical for maintaining function in affected cats.

  3. Long-Term Joint Health:
    Long-term joint health benefits from consistent use of Solensia through its ability to address inflammatory processes affecting the joints. The ongoing administration of Solensia may lead to sustained improvement in joint function and potentially slow the progression of osteoarthritis. A longitudinal study by Brodbelt et al. (2021) indicates that cats receiving Solensia exhibited less joint damage over time compared to those on traditional analgesics.

  4. Minimal Side Effects:
    Minimal side effects associated with Solensia make it a suitable option for long-term therapy. Clinical trials have reported fewer adverse effects compared to conventional n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). Cats on Solensia demonstrated a lower incidence of gastrointestinal issues and renal complications, as highlighted in an article by Carlos et al. (2021). This safety profile allows veterinarians to comfortably prescribe it for chronic conditions.

  5. Ease of Administration:
    Ease of administration is a significant advantage of Solensia, as it is given via a subcutaneous injection once a month. This method is less stressful for both cats and owners compared to daily oral medications. According to a survey of cat owners conducted by the International Society of Feline Medicine, 85% preferred injection therapy for its convenience and effectiveness.

  6. Support for Overall Well-Being:
    Support for overall well-being is another important aspect of Solensia treatment. By alleviating pain and enhancing mobility, cats can maintain a healthier, more active lifestyle. The interaction of physical activity with mental stimulation fosters better behavioral health. Research by Lillie et al. (2022) indicates that cats receiving effective arthritis treatment are more social and engaged with their human companions, further adding to their quality of life.

What Are the Potential Side Effects of Solensia in Felines?

The potential side effects of Solensia in felines include various health issues, though not all cats will experience them.

  1. Injection site reactions
  2. Vomiting
  3. Diarrhea
  4. Lethargy
  5. Reduced appetite
  6. Allergic reactions

The side effects of Solensia may vary based on individual cat characteristics and health conditions.

  1. Injection Site Reactions: Injection site reactions occur when the cat experiences discomfort or swelling at the location where the injection was given. These reactions can include redness, swelling, or tenderness. According to a study published by the Merck Veterinary Manual, local reactions may resolve within a few days without intervention.

  2. Vomiting: Vomiting is a possible side effect of Solensia. It may occur as the cat’s gastrointestinal system reacts to the medication. In a clinical trial involving Solensia, approximately 5% of participating cats experienced vomiting. Veterinary experts recommend monitoring the cat for severe or persistent vomiting and consulting a veterinarian if necessary.

  3. Diarrhea: Diarrhea is another gastrointestinal side effect noted in some felines after receiving Solensia. The reaction can stem from changes in gut flora or direct effects on intestinal function. A report by the Veterinary Clinics of North America indicated that dietary factors combined with medication can contribute to such side effects.

  4. Lethargy: Lethargy refers to a state of decreased energy and activity levels. Some cats may exhibit lethargy after receiving Solensia. Lethargy can affect a cat’s overall quality of life if persistent, necessitating veterinary attention. The American Animal Hospital Association emphasizes that such behavioral changes warrant further evaluation.

  5. Reduced Appetite: Reduced appetite is a common side effect observed in cats after receiving various medications, including Solensia. Cats may become less interested in food, leading to weight loss over time. Monitoring a cat’s eating habits following medication administration is crucial, as prolonged reduced appetite may signal other underlying issues.

  6. Allergic Reactions: Allergic reactions can manifest in various ways, such as swelling, itching, or difficulty breathing. Although rare, they can occur following the administration of Solensia. According to the ASPCA, any signs of an allergic reaction should be treated as an emergency, requiring immediate veterinary intervention.

How Does Solensia Compare to Other Injectable Treatments for Cat Arthritis?

Solensia is an injectable treatment for cat arthritis that is part of a new class of drugs called monoclonal antibodies. Here is a comparison of Solensia with other commonly used injectable treatments:

TreatmentMechanism of ActionAdministration FrequencySide EffectsEffectivenessCost
SolensiaMonoclonal antibody targeting nerve growth factor (NGF)Once a monthGenerally well-tolerated; may include mild gastrointestinal upsetEffective in reducing pain associated with osteoarthritisModerate to high cost
Steroids (e.g., Corticosteroids)Anti-inflammatory agents that suppress immune responseVaries; often used as neededIncreased thirst, urination, weight gain, potential for long-term side effectsEffective for short-term pain reliefVariable cost
Hyaluronic AcidViscosupplementation to improve joint lubricationOnce every few weeks to monthsGenerally safe; rare allergic reactionsVariable effectiveness; may help some catsModerate cost
NSAIDs (e.g., Meloxicam)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ugsDaily or as prescribedGastrointestinal upset, liver or kidney issues with long-term useEffective for pain managementLow to moderate cost

This table highlights key differences in treatment mechanisms, administration frequency, potential side effects, effectiveness, and cost, making it easier to evaluate the options available for managing cat arthritis.

Where Can Cat Owners Find and Purchase Solensia for Their Cats?

Cat owners can find and purchase Solensia for their cats at veterinary clinics. Veterinarians prescribe this medication specifically for cats suffering from osteoarthritis. Owners should schedule an appointment with a veterinarian to discuss their cat’s symptoms. After evaluation, the veterinarian can recommend Solensia if appropriate.

In addition to clinics, some online pet pharmacies may offer Solensia. Owners can check these websites, ensuring they are licensed and reputable. It is essential to have a prescription from a veterinarian before purchasing Solensia online. Always verify the authenticity of the website to avoid counterfeit products.
